How To Write A Job Application Letter In Cameroon (Example)

A job application letter in Cameroon is the most integral part of a job application. You use this to show the employer that you are uniquely qualified for the vacancy or position you are applying for.

Therefore, a well-written job application letter is paramount to you getting shortlisted for an interview.

However, most people overlook this necessary procedure and make mistakes that cost them employment or job opportunities.

How To Write A Job Application Letter For Employment In Cameroon

How To Write A Job Application Letter In Cameroon

Here are some mandatory tips on how to write a successful and perfect job application letter in Cameroon:

  • Tailor-make the job application letter
  • Give a relevant experience.
  • Address the recipient
  • Make it short

1. Tailor-make the Job Application letter

Most people think they can use the same generic or sample cover letter to apply for all the jobs. This is not true as every position is different. Hence, such a cover letter should also be other.

2. Give relevant experience.

For example, when applying for a Finance position, it is vital that whatever experience you put in the job application letter be related to finance. 

There is no point in giving your sales experience unless the job description asks explicitly for someone with sales experience.

Giving irrelevant experience takes up space and does not show that you are best suited for the position.

3. Address the recipient

When drafting your job application letter, you must address it to the one who will receive it by their last name.

Make sure you find out who will get your job application letter and use their name in the salutation instead of dear sir/madam. This will show that you took the time to research and are genuinely interested in the position.

Write A Job Application Letter In Cameroon

4. Make it short

There is no point in having a job application letter that is 2 pages long. The hiring managers do not have time to read through all this, so your application will be thrown out.

The trick is to keep it short and cover the essential parts.

How to Write job Application letter to Cameroon GCE Board

(gettoc) $title= (table of contents), introduction.

The Cameroon GCE Board always provides jobs to interested job applications willing to work with them before, during and after Gce sessions Every year. This is usually called Gce board holiday jobs . During this period, Many people are submitting their job application letters to the GCE board. 

To stand out of this population of these job seekers, you need to Write a Unique job application letter to the Cameroon GCE exams board. Today I will share with you the requirements and how to write a job application letter to the Cameroon GCE Board.

To write a job application letter to the Cameroon GCE exams Board is as easy as ABC.

You only need to write a normal formal letter which includes the following key points:

Your Address top Right

The GCE Board examinations Address

The heading

Conclusion and sign

Attachments

Also read how to write Job winning CV in Cameroon

1, Your Address top Right : 

Write your own address Top Right hand side of the paper.

For example: 

Mbah Monono Felix

South West region

+237673……

07 July, 2022

2,The GCE Board examinations Address

The management

Cameroon General certificate of Education Board

3,The heading:

Application for Holiday Job 

Salutations: 

If you know the sex of the person, use it if not use "Dear sir/Madam"

4,The Body:

I Mbah Monono Felix, A Cameroonian by Nationality and holder of ( your highest certificate) writes to Apply for a holiday job as recently announced by your Institution.

If given the Job, I will make sure I perform any task given to me.

5,Conclusion and sign:

While waiting for your request, I remain your humble Applicant.

6 Attachments :

Find enclosed:

Photocopy of ( name All certificate and CV you are adding in your file)

Make sure you make everything simple and straight to the point

See draft job application letter on picture below

Requirements to Submit a job application letter at the Cameroon GCE examinations Board:

To make a complete file and submit, the application file should comprised of the following:

GCE examination Board Application Form

Hand written Application

Photocopy of National ID Card

Photocopy of certificate

To get this holiday job, applicants fill a form and attach a photocopy of their ID card, the highest certificate of education.

Writing a holiday job application letter to the GCE examination Board is simple and straightforward like any other job. The only unique thing about this one is that you need to Address it to the right quarters and Also use the Necessary documents as explained detailly above.

Key Elements of Application Letter:

A well-crafted application letter typically includes the following key elements:

Contact Information: Include your own contact details (name, address, phone number, email) at the top of the letter.

Date: The date when you are writing the letter.

Recipient's Contact Information: The name, title, and address of the person or organization to whom you are sending the application.

Salutation: A polite and specific greeting, addressing the recipient. If you don't know the name, use a general salutation, such as "Dear Hiring Manager."

Body Paragraphs: This is where you explain your qualifications, skills, and experiences that make you a suitable candidate for the job.

Closing Paragraph: Summarize your interest in the position, express your desire for an interview, and thank the recipient for considering your application.

Closing Salutation: Use a courteous closing like "Sincerely" or "Yours truly," followed by your name.

These seven elements form the core structure of an effective application letter.

While applying to jobs, you might be asked to provide a job application letter (sometimes referred to as a cover letter) along with your resume. A resume outlines your professional skills and experience, and a job application letter explains why you are an ideal candidate for the position you’re applying to.

You can think of this as a strictly formatted professional letter that gives hiring managers a sense of your individual qualities prior to a job interview.

This article outlines the essential details and formatting for a job application letter. You’ll learn how to write a concise and engaging letter that will increase your chances of being selected for an interview.

Key Takeaways:

A job application letter can also be known as a cover letter. It is a way to introduce how your skills and experience are a good match for the job.

A job application letter should have your contact information, employer contact information, and a salutation,

A job application application letter should have an introductory paragraph, middle paragraphs that explain your qualifications, and a closing paragraph.

Use specific experiences with quantifiable results to show how your skills were successfully put into action.

Make sure to do your research and edit your letter before submitting.

How To Write A Job Application Letter (With Examples)

Tips for writing a job application letter

Job application letter format, what’s the difference between a cover letter and a job application letter, dos and don’ts for writing a job application letter.

  • Sign Up For More Advice and Jobs

If you’ve ever asked for advice on the job application process, you’ve likely heard the phrase “sell yourself” a million times over. This means that you should highlight your skills and achievements in a way that will pique a hiring manager ’s interest and make them pause over your application.

You might feel overwhelmed in the grand scheme of online applications, application/ cover letters , letters of intent , and interviews. It’s a lot to balance, especially if you have no experience with any of the things listed.

Remember to take everything one step at a time and review some helpful tips for writing a polished and engaging job application letter:

Tailor the application letter to each job. Your letter should address key points in the job description from the listing, as well as how you can apply your knowledge and experience to the position. You want to emphasize why you are the best candidate for this specific job.

Don’t copy information straight from your resume. Your resume is meant to act as a formal record of your professional experience, education, and accomplishments. The job application letter is where you highlight a few particular details from your resume, and use them to demonstrate how your experience can apply to the job.

Follow the business letter format. These letters have very strict formatting rules, to ensure that they appear as professional to hiring managers. A poorly formatted letter could prevent employers from taking your application seriously.

Proofread. Hiring managers will definitely overlook letters riddled with proofreading mistakes. Read your letter several times over to fix any grammar, punctuation, or spelling errors. You could ask someone else to look over it afterwards or run it through any number of online grammar check programs.

Decide on printing and mailing your letter or sending it in an email. An application letter sent through email requires a subject line that details your purpose for writing— consider “[job title], [your name].” The placement of your contact information is also different depending on the medium . In a hard copy, this goes at the top of your letter, as a header. In an email, it goes below your signature.

A cover letter normally is attached with a resume for a specific job opening, whereas a job application letter can be submitted independently. As already stated, a job application letter can also be known as a cover letter. Format wise, there are a lot of similarities.

However, a job application letter can also be more detailed than a cover a letter. Usually a cover letter acts a quick introduction to a resume when a candidate applies for a specific job opening.

Meanwhile, you can submit a job application letter to a company even if there are no job openings. In this case, you would provide more detail about yourself and your qualifications. Due to this, job application letters tend to be a little longer than the average cover letter.

Now that we’ve gone through the basic formatting for a job application letter and a few examples of what one might look like, how can we condense all that information into digestible pieces?

Refer to these lists of “dos” and “don’ts” to help you through your drafting process:

Explain what you can bring to the company. Consider: how is your experience relevant to what the hiring manager is looking for?

Discuss your skills. Pick out a few skills listed in your resume and describe how you have utilized them in the workplace.

Give specific examples to support your experience. Is there a major project you worked on at your last job ? Did you accomplish something significant in your previous position? Including examples of these things in your letter will add new, specific content to your application and make you more interesting.

Edit your letter thoroughly. Read your letter a couple times, pass it off to someone to look over, run it through an online grammar check. Make sure it’s free of any errors.

Don’t focus on what the job can do for you. While it might seem nice to write that a job is your dream job or that you’ve always wanted to work with a company, it can read as vague flattery. Remember, this letter is about your qualifications.

Don’t list your current or previous job description. Your education and work experience certainly have value, but don’t just list your degrees and places you’ve worked at. Explained what you learned from those experiences and how they’ve made you a strong employee.

Don’t paste directly from your resume. A job application letter is meant to add to your value as a candidate, not just reiterate the same information repeatedly. Use your resume as a guide , but expand on especially relevant details.

Don’t submit an unedited letter. Before an employer ever meets you, they see your application and your job application letter. You don’t want grammar errors and misspelled words to make a bad first impression, so make sure to edit your draft multiple times.

A   letter of application, also known as a  cover letter , is a document sent with your resume to provide additional information about your skills and experience to an employer. Your letter of application is intended to provide detailed information on why you are an ideal candidate for the job.

Your application letter should let the employer know what position you are applying for, what makes you a strong candidate, why they should select you for an interview, and how you will follow up.

Effective application letters explain the reasons for your interest in the specific organization and identify the most relevant skills that qualify you for the job.

Your application letter should let the employer know what position you are applying for, explain your qualifications for the job, why you should be selected for an interview, and how you will follow up.

Unless an employer specifically requests a job application letter sent by postal mail, today most cover letters are sent by email or attached as a file in an online application tracking system.

As with all cover letters, a job application letter is divided into sections:

  • The heading includes your name and contact information.
  • A  greeting  addressed to a specific person, if possible.
  • The introduction includes why the applicant is writing.
  • The body discusses your relevant qualifications and what you have to offer the employer.
  • The close thanks the reader and provides contact information and follow-up details.
  • Your  signature to end the letter .

Here’s how to ensure that your application supports your resume, highlights your most relevant qualifications, and impresses the hiring manager.

Get off to a direct start.  In your first paragraph, explain why you are writing. Mention the job title and company name, and where you found the job listing. While you can also briefly mention why you are a strong candidate, this section should be short and to the point.

Offer something different than what's in your resume. You can make your language a bit more personal than in your resume bullet points, and you can tell a narrative about your work experience and career.

Application letters typically accompany resumes, so your letter should showcase information that your resume doesn't.

Make a good case.  Your first goal with this letter is to progress to the next step: an interview. Your overarching goal, of course, is to get a job offer. Use your application letter to further both causes. Offer details about your experience and background that show why you are a good candidate. How have other jobs prepared you for the position? What would you bring to the position, and to the company? Use this space to  emphasize your strengths .

Close with all the important details.  Include a thank you at the end of your letter. You can also share your contact information and mention how you will follow up.

How to Send an Email Application Letter

If sending your cover letter via email, list your name and the job title you are applying for in the  subject line  of the email:

Colleen Warren - Web Content Manager Position

Include your contact information in your email signature but don't list the employer's contact information.

Do you have to write a cover letter when you apply for a job?

Some employers require cover letters. If they do, it will be mentioned in the job posting. Otherwise, it’s optional but it can help your chances of securing an interview. A cover letter gives you a chance to sell yourself to the employer, showcase your qualifications, and explain why you are a perfect candidate for the job.

How can you use a cover letter to show you’re a qualified candidate?

One of the easiest ways to show an employer how you’re qualified for a job is to make a list of the requirements listed in the job posting and match them to your resume. Mention your most relevant qualifications in your cover letter, so the hiring manager can see, at a glance, that you have the credentials they are looking for.
